The NRS Healthcare Sock and Hosiery Helper is a compact, lightweight dressing aid designed to assist individuals with limited strength or bending difficulties in putting on socks, stockings, or tights. Measuring 20.32 x 17.78 x 34.29 cm and weighing 790 grams, it reduces the need to bend while seated, making daily dressing easier and more comfortable. Not suitable for strong compression stockings.

Beware if you want this to don a compression stocking. Not suitable.
As one reviewer said the space for the foot is very small and once the calf enters the space the frame is too small for even a user with slim lower legs. Also, once the foot starts to engage with the stocking the frame under the pressure of the compression stocking moves up the leg and so the foot doesn't engage fully with the full foot of the stocking. With the foot half in the foot of the stocking but the rest of the stocking pulled up to the knee - the stocking still has to be eased on to heel fit into the heel. If the user could reach their toe to put on a stocking they would not need this aid. It might be better to get a helper with longer arms as the user also has to bend down to their ankle to grab hold of the handles - and they also need to then in this position bent forward of raising their knee high enough to get their foot into the heel opening. But first they need strong wrists and fingers to pull the stocking down over the frame. This might work for normal stockings but not medically prescribed compression stockings. Once their foot is starting to engage with the opening they need to rock back and tilt the frame up otherwise the back of the "smile" of the top ring digs into the leg. If someone is able to do this then they probably don't need such an appliance. Disappointing as I have to do this everyday for my mother and her compression stocking can not be left off. I don't think this is suitable for a weak person in hands, wrists or arms and with limited ability to bend forward and pull hard and consistently to slide the stocking on.

Very useful.
After struggling to put on compression for a while, this helper makes life much easier, although physical strength is still required. At least, when I have to use 40 mmHg compression ( imagine if you will, trying get your leg into a motorcycle inner-tube) I am able to do so without help from a second person. Removal is also much easier. My only (slightly) negative comment is the width of the foot access. I find this a little tight (having large and broad feet!). May see if I can bend the frame open a bit, without damaging the plastic coating, which would be a disaster. Would suggest not using it standing up (unless you can contort your foot to lie parallel to your leg (as in ballet)). Easier is sitting in a chair, or in my case, on the floor, back against a wall.
